Writing Scope Discovery "**Let's estimate the writing scope for {{game_name}}.** **Scope elements:** - **Word count estimate** - Total written content - **Scene/chapter count** - Major narrative sections - **Dialogue lines** - Approximate line count - **Branching complexity** - How much unique content per path? **For reference:** - Light narrative game: ~5,000-15,000 words - Moderate narrative: ~15,000-50,000 words - Heavy narrative: ~50,000-150,000 words - Story-driven/Visual novel: 100,000+ words Estimate your writing scope:" ### 2. Localization Discovery "**Are you planning localization?** **Localization considerations:** - **Target languages** - Which languages? - **Cultural adaptation** - What needs to change per region? - **Text expansion** - Some languages use 30% more space - **UI implications** - Can UI handle longer text? - **Audio implications** - Will you dub or subtitle? Describe your localization plans (or indicate English-only):" ### 3. Voice Acting Discovery "**What are your voice acting plans?** **Voice acting scope:** - **Fully voiced** - All dialogue recorded - **Partially voiced** - Key scenes only - **Grunts/barks only** - No full dialogue - **Text only** - No voice acting **If voiced:** - Number of characters needing voices? - Approximate dialogue volume? - Professional or placeholder voices? Describe your voice acting approach:" ### 4.
